Activity Dependent Degeneration Explains Hub Vulnerability in Alzheimer's Disease

Brain connectivity studies have revealed that highly connected ‘hub’ regions are particularly vulnerable to Alzheimer pathology: they show marked amyloid-β deposition at an early stage.
